RESUMEN

After traumatic brain injury (TBI), the relationship between age and outcome at 1 year, including quality of life, has been poorly explored. The aim of our study was to describe this relationship in a cohort of TBI patients in a regional trauma system. Consecutive TBI patients with severe lesions on initial brain computed tomography (CT) scan were included from July 2014 to July 2016 in two French level-1 trauma centers. The primary outcome was the mortality at 1 year and secondary outcomes were Glasgow Outcome Scale-Extended (GOS-E) and quality of life using the Short Form Health Survey (SF-12). The relationship between age and outcome was modeled using the generalized linear model (GLM). Within the study period, 427 patients with TBI and type 3 Abbreviated Injury Scale (AIS) lesions were included. Finally, 380 patients were assessed for mortality. Ninety-six (25%) patients died at 1 year. The detailed neurological status was available for 317 patients. One year after the trauma, 141 (44%) patients had a favorable outcome (GOS-E 7 and 8), whereas 53 (17%) patients had a moderate disability (GOS-E 5-6), 27 (9%) patients had a severe disability or were in a vegetative state (GOS-E 2-4), and 96 (30%) patients had died (GOS-E 1). After 70 years of age, a dramatic increase in the odds of death and poor neurological outcome was found using GLM. No difference according to age was found for the quality of life. After TBI, the mortality at 1 year dramatically increased with age after 70 years. For elderly survivors, impairment of quality of life was not different from younger patients.

RESUMEN

BACKGROUND: Despite various treatments to control intracranial pressure (ICP) after brain injury, patients may present a late onset of high ICP or a poor response to medications. External lumbar drainage (ELD) can be considered a therapeutic option if high ICP is due to communicating external hydrocephalus. We aimed at describing the efficacy and safety of ELD used in a cohort of traumatic or non-traumatic brain-injured patients. METHODS: In this multicentre retrospective analysis, patients had a delayed onset of high ICP after the initial injury and/or a poor response to ICP treatments. ELD was considered in the presence of radiological signs of communicating external hydrocephalus. Changes in ICP values and side effects following the ELD procedure were reported. RESULTS: Thirty-three patients with a median age of 51 years (25-75th percentile: 34-61 years) were admitted after traumatic (n = 22) or non-traumatic (n = 11) brain injuries. Their initial Glasgow Coma Scale score was 8 (4-11). Eight patients underwent external ventricular drainage prior to ELD. Median time to ELD insertion was 5 days (4-8) after brain insult. In all patients, ELD was dramatically effective in lowering ICP: 25 mmHg (20-31) before versus 7 mmHg (3-10) after (p < 0.001). None of the patients showed adverse effects such as pupil changes or intracranial bleeding after the procedure. One patient developed an ELD-related infection. CONCLUSIONS: These findings indicate that ELD may be considered potentially effective in controlling ICP, remaining safe if a firm diagnosis of communicating external hydrocephalus has been made.

RESUMEN

We present the case of an Addison's disease revealed by a serious hyponatremia. The serum concentration of ACTH and 21-hydroxylase antibodies were increased and lead to the diagnosis. The cortisol blood level was lowered but required to take into account the stress induced by the hospitalisation of the patient. Addison's disease is characterized by the destruction of the adrenal cortex. Autoimmune adrenalitis is the main cause of adrenal insufficiency. Treatment involves normalisation of sodium concentration and corticosteroids replacement. With a good patient compliance, the survival rate of Addisonian patient is similar to that of the normal population. Management of patient requires vigilance because of the occurrence of others autoimmunes diseases during patient life.

RESUMEN

Critically ill patients with infection in the intensive care unit (ICU) would certainly benefit from timely bacterial identification and effective antimicrobial treatment. Diagnostic techniques have clearly improved in the last years and allow earlier identification of bacterial strains in some cases, but these techniques are still quite expensive and not readily available in all institutions. Moreover, the ever increasing rates of resistance to antimicrobials, especially in Gram-negative pathogens, are threatening the outcome for such patients because of the lack of effective medical treatment; ICU physicians are therefore resorting to combination therapies to overcome resistance, with the direct consequence of promoting further resistance. A more appropriate use of available antimicrobials in the ICU should be pursued, and adjustments in doses and dosing through pharmacokinetics and pharmacodynamics have recently shown promising results in improving outcomes and reducing antimicrobial resistance. The aim of multidisciplinary antimicrobial stewardship programs is to improve antimicrobial prescription, and in this review we analyze the available experiences of such programs carried out in ICUs, with emphasis on results, challenges, and pitfalls. Any effective intervention aimed at improving antibiotic usage in ICUs must be brought about at the present time; otherwise, we will face the challenge of intractable infections in critically ill patients in the near future.
